Monroney Proposes Federal Commission on Auto Safety

Sen. Monroney announces a bill to create a presidential commission to unify safety efforts, collect crash data, and propose nationwide reports, tests for interstate drivers, and possible federal funding for highway fixes and uniform traffic codes. He notes 38 800 auto deaths this year and 1 856 000 serious accidents. The panel would include governors, automotive groups, and legislators.

Christmas at Sea Dutch Leave Indonesia for Holland

More than 1 200 Dutch nationals board the Captain Cook and begin Christmas voyage home as Indonesia signals willingness to negotiate over West New Guinea. Authorities say about 9 000 Dutch remain. talks in The Hague and Jakarta hint at possible resolutions.

Man’s Body Washed Ashore Near Avon North Carolina

The body of Frank Lee Forrest III, 32, of Hampton Virginia, was found washed ashore four miles north of Avon. He was one of four crewmen missing after their trawler Sea Dog wrecked December 7. Forrest was identified by relatives at a Manteo funeral home and taken to Hampton. The other missing crewmen are Captain Eldridge Holloway of Pocomoke Ralph Gibbs of Hampton and Henry Abernathy of Gloucester County.

Scott Convicted of First Degree Murder in Corpseless Case

A California jury found L. Ewing Scott guilty of first degree murder in the disappearance of his wife Evelyn Throsby Scott, a case built on circumstantial evidence. He faces potential death by gas chamber or life imprisonment after a trial that ran 11 weeks with 125 witnesses and no defense testimony.

Deputies Halt Big Cock Fight Near Travelers Rest

Deputies stopped a large cock fight near Travelers Rest Greenville count. A total of 162 men from the Carolinas Virginia Georgia and Tennessee were arrested. Thirteen escaped. Each arrestee posted a five dollar bond totaling 810 dollars.
